#!/usr/bin/env python3
# -*- coding: utf-8 -*-
"""
Created on Tue Oct 16 10:49:16 2018
@author: u1490431
"""
import numpy as np
import csv
def medfilereader(filename, varsToExtract = 'all',
sessionToExtract = 1,
verbose = False,
remove_var_header = False):
if varsToExtract == 'all':
numVarsToExtract = np.arange(0,26)
else:
numVarsToExtract = [ord(x)-97 for x in varsToExtract]
f = open(filename, 'r')
f.seek(0)
filerows = f.readlines()[8:]
datarows = [isnumeric(x) for x in filerows]
matches = [i for i,x in enumerate(datarows) if x == 0.3]
if sessionToExtract > len(matches):
print('Session ' + str(sessionToExtract) + ' does not exist.')
if verbose == True:
print('There are ' + str(len(matches)) + ' sessions in ' + filename)
print('Analyzing session ' + str(sessionToExtract))
varstart = matches[sessionToExtract - 1]
medvars = [[] for n in range(26)]
k = int(varstart + 27)
for i in range(26):
medvarsN = int(datarows[varstart + i + 1])
medvars[i] = datarows[k:k + int(medvarsN)]
k = k + medvarsN
if remove_var_header == True:
varsToReturn = [medvars[i][1:] for i in numVarsToExtract]
else:
varsToReturn = [medvars[i] for i in numVarsToExtract]
if np.shape(varsToReturn)[0] == 1:
varsToReturn = varsToReturn[0]
return varsToReturn
def metafilereader(filename):
f = open(filename, 'r')
f.seek(0)
header = f.readlines()[0]
f.seek(0)
filerows = f.readlines()[1:]
tablerows = []
for i in filerows:
tablerows.append(i.split('\t'))
header = header.split('\t')
# need to find a way to strip end of line \n from last column - work-around is to add extra dummy column at end of metafile
return tablerows, header
def isnumeric(s):
try:
x = float(s)
return x
except ValueError:
return float('nan')
def writemed2csv(medfile, varsToExtract):
varsout = []
for v in varsToExtract:
varsout.append(medfilereader(medfile,
varsToExtract=v,
remove_var_header = True))
print(varsout)
with open(medfile+'.csv', 'w', newline="") as f:
c = csv.writer(f)
for v in varsout:
c.writerows(zip(v[0], v[1]))
